Tour the locations that likely inspired Herman Melville to capture New Bedford in Chapters 2-13 of Moby Dick. Visit the Seamen’s Bethel, “the Whaleman’s Chapel” in Melville’s novel. See the Rodman House, which exemplifies the “opulent” and “patrician like houses,” which Melville noted characterized New Bedford.
